Torque or moment represents the ability of a force to twist rotate the body around a specific axis. It is the product of the magnitude of the force and its perpendicular distance to the axis, and we can express it using the following cross-product :. Learn more about calculating torque using our torque calculator. The SI unit of torque is Newton-meter N-m. One Newton-meter torque is the rotational twist produced by one Newton force acting one meter perpendicular distance away from the rotational axis. Pound-foot lbs-ft or ft-lbs : Pound-foot lb-ft is the British gravitational system unit for torque. One pound-foot is the equivalent torque produced by a one pound-force acting one foot away perpendicular distance from the axis of rotation. Often in practice, foot-pound ft-lb is used in place of pound-foot lb-ft , but you must exercise caution while doing so because foot-pound is a unit of energy see our energy converter. Kilogram-centimeter kg-cm or kilogram force-centimeter kgf-cm : Kilogram-centimeter or kilogram force-centimeter is an non-standard unit of torque. It is the torque produced by a one kilogram-force acting one centimeter away perpendicular distance from the rotational axis.

Specifically, it quantifies the energy transferred to an object when subjected to a one-newton force applied in the direction of its motion over a distance of one meter. Origin: The adoption of the newton-meter as a unit for work or energy stems from the dimensional equivalence between the joule, the internationally recognized SI unit for energy, and the newton-meter. Current Usage: While the Newton meter is traditionally associated with measuring torque, its application as a unit for work or energy is discouraged. This precaution is taken to prevent potential confusion between expressions of energy and torque, emphasizing the importance of clarity in scientific and engineering contexts.
